Metastatic melanoma: therapeutic agents in preclinical and early clinical development

Advanced melanoma treatments like targeted therapies and immune checkpoint inhibitors (IC) offer durable responses. However, overcoming treatment resistance requires exploring novel agents, combinations, and personalized strategies for better outcomes.

Background:

  • Advanced melanoma historically had poor outcomes.
  • Targeted therapies and immune checkpoint inhibitors (IC) have improved outcomes.
  • Most patients eventually develop progressive disease, necessitating new strategies.

Purpose of the Study:

  • To review current and emerging treatment strategies for advanced melanoma.
  • To discuss novel targeted agents, IC, immune-modulatory drugs, cancer vaccines, and tumor-infiltrating lymphocytes.
  • To present ongoing clinical trials and the rationale for new therapeutic approaches.

Main Methods:

  • Literature review of current treatment strategies and landmark trials.
  • Search of ClinicalTrials.gov for ongoing trials of emerging agents and strategies.
  • Synthesis of existing literature with new trial data to explain therapeutic rationale.

Main Results:

  • Novel targeted agents and ICs offer durable responses in advanced melanoma.
  • Combinations of tumor-directed agents with immune-augmenting drugs show promise.
  • Adjuvant and neoadjuvant strategies are being investigated.

Conclusions:

  • Personalized treatment, combination therapies, and sequencing guided by biomarkers are crucial.
  • New treatment settings will expand patient selection and necessitate long-term toxicity management.
